The Republic of Senegal, is a West African country.

It is bordered by the Atlantic Ocean to the west, Mauritania to the north and east, Mali to the east, and Guinea and Guinea-Bissau to the south.
Welcoming, warm and hospitable, it is a crossroads of ethnicities and traditions, land of Wolof, Pulaar (Fulani pastoralists and Toucouleurs of the Senegal River Valley), Soninke, Jola of Casamance, the Serer of Sine and Mandingo, all contributing to the cultural richness of the country.

Language
- French is the official language.
- Are spoken, according to ethnic groups, Wolof, Fula, Serer, the Madringue, Soninke and Diola.
- English, Portuguese, Italian, Spanish, German, Russian and literary Arabic are also spoken by many Sénagalais.

Entry requirements in Senegal
- The passport must be valid (not expired in a minimum of 3 months after the end of the stay in Senegal).
- Nationals of Member States of the European Union, the ECOWAS countries, the United States, Canada, Japan and some North African countries do not require visas.
- For other countries, participants should check with the embassies, consulates and other representations of Senegal in their country to obtain the visa.
- It is recommended to take out travel insurance to cover your stay in Senegal. The vaccination certificate must be updated and it is mandatory for the traveler.
Vaccination and Health
- Vaccination against yellow fever is required for entry to Senegal.
- It is strongly recommended to consult your doctor before your trip, the health status of each traveler may require a different preventive treatment.
Strongly recommended vaccines
hepatitis A, typhoid fever, diphtheria, tetanus, poliomyelitis, yellow fever
Sometimes recommended vaccines
tuberculosis, hepatitis B, cerebrospinal meningitis, Rage
Chaloupe Schedule
Service to Goree Island, located 2.5 km off Dakar, is provided by boats whose management and operation are entrusted to the Directorate of Autonomous Port of Dakar through the Maritime Liaison Dakar-Goree (LMDG).
No reservations, the ticket is taken on site. Journey time: 20 minutes.
Chaloupe Fees
Nationaux
Children 500 FCFA Adult 1 500 FCFA
Goréan people
Children 50 FCFA Adult 100 FCFA
Non African résidents
Children 2 500 FCFA Adult 5 000 FCFA
African Résidents
Children 1 500 FCFA Adult 2 500 FCFA
